Why is it important for Christians to have a good ground heart?

Answered in 1 source

A good ground heart is essential for truly receiving God's Word and producing spiritual fruit.

For Christians, having a good ground heart is paramount as it signifies a heart that is prepared by God to receive His Word. This heart is free from rocks and thorns which symbolize distractions, sin, and worldly concerns that hinder spiritual growth. According to Mark 4:20, those sown on good ground are they who hear the Word, receive it, and bear fruit. The fruit produced is evidence of genuine faith—characteristics of the Holy Spirit such as love, joy, and peace. Without that prepared heart, individuals risk joining the wayside, stony, or thorny hearers, which results in unfruitfulness and spiritual barrenness. Thus, the importance of a good ground heart is closely tied to the believer’s growth and walk with Christ.
Scripture References: Mark 4:20, Galatians 5:22-23
